Responsibilities
- Your responsibilities will include:
- Identify and document Critical Data Attributes (CDAs) and support the governance of Critical Data Elements (CDEs) in your domain area
- Analyse data to assess quality, identify issues, and support root cause investigations
- Define and maintain data definitions, rules, thresholds, and supporting documentation used in monitoring and control activities
- Contribute to ensuring data is accurate, consistent, and fit for business use
- Monitor quality outputs, track remediation activities, and escalate blockers where data issues are not being resolved
- Collaborate with data owners, stewards, and stakeholders across business and technology
- Support the implementation of data governance practices and controls
- A key part of the role is ensuring that documentation is clear, structured, and maintainable, enabling transparency and consistency across the organisation.
Requirements
- We are looking for someone who is structured, curious, and motivated to work with data in a business context:
- Experience in data analysis, data quality, or a related field
- Strong analytical mindset and attention to detail
- Ability to understand data in the context of business processes
- Strong communication skills and ability to collaborate across teams
- Ability to produce clear and structured documentation
- Experience with SQL or similar tools is an advantage
- Experience with Great Expectation or Databricks is an advantage

Copenhagen HQ, Denmark Looking for your next career opportunity within Data Governance, where you can expand your critical data expertise in a fintech organisation? Join us in building a new data capability in Markets At Saxo, we are building the Markets Data Office as part of the Data Governance Programme. The function is structured across four domain areas Products, Operations, Counterparty Risk, and Market Risk reflecting how critical data is used across Markets. As a Data Portfolio Analyst, you will work within one of these domain areas and help improve how critical data is defined, monitored, and controlled. Your work will contribute to establishing consistent ways of working across the Markets Data Office, while supporting domain-specific needs. While your focus will be within a specific domain area, you will operate as part of a single Markets Data Office with shared standards, tooling, and governance practices. This is an opportunity to join early, shape how we work, and make a real impact on how data is governed at scale.
